Linea Loretta Bishop Salmen; Homemaker

Share

Linea Loretta Bishop Salmen, a homemaker, died suddenly Friday at her home in Oak View. She was 46.

One of five children, Salmen was born in Los Angeles on Nov. 5, 1950.

Her brother, Eric Bishop of Berkeley, said Salmen was a devoted mother who did everything to make life better for her children. “Her children were her life,” he said.

Bishop said his sister became the family historian. “Linea collected photographs of our family. She had literally an archive of remembrances going back to my grandfather.”

In addition to Bishop, Salmen is survived by four children, Carlotta, Andrew, Travis and Heidi, all of Oak View; her mother, Ymelda Waller of Oak View; her father, Jack Bishop of Santa Fe, N.M.; a brother, Roland Bishop of San Diego; two sisters, Ymelda Kuyath of England and Celeste Tillman of Watsonville, and numerous nieces and nephews.

Graveside services will be held today at 12:30 p.m. at Ivy Lawn Memorial Park in Ventura.

Arrangements are under the direction of Ted Mayr Funeral Home, Ventura.
